The Importance of Regular Testing
Routine medical testing is vital for different reasons, consisting of:
Early Detection of Diseases: Certain health concerns, like hypertension or diabetes, can establish without noticeable symptoms. Routine testing assists recognize these conditions early, enabling prompt interventions.
Keeping Track Of Health Changes: For individuals with persistent conditions, routine tests are essential for monitoring the efficiency of treatments and medications.
Avoidance: Many health issue can be avoided through way of life modifications and timely medical interventions based upon test outcomes.
Educated Decision-Making: Being mindful of one's health status empowers adults to make educated choices regarding their lifestyle and health care choices.
Provided these points, integrating regular testing into one's health regimen is vital for cultivating long-lasting wellness.
Recommended Tests for Adults
The following table summarizes essential health tests recommended for adults, based upon age and gender:
Age Group (Years)
Gender
Suggested Tests
18 – 30
Both
- Basic health examination
- Blood pressure screening
- STD screening (specifically for sexually active adults)
- Mental health screening
30 – 40
Both
- Cholesterol test (every 4— 6 years)
- Diabetes screening (especially if obese)
- Blood pressure check
- Pap smear (for ladies, every 3 years)
40 – 50
Both
- Comprehensive metabolic panel
- Mammograms (for females, every year after 40)
- Screening for colon cancer (beginning at age 45)
- Prostate health conversation (for men)
50+
Both
- Regular screenings for heart disease
- Bone density scan (for females, particularly post-menopause)
- Annual flu shot and other vaccinations as recommended
Note: The testing frequency and types might vary based upon private health risks, household history, and way of life elements. It's crucial for adults to discuss with their health care suppliers for customized recommendations.
Common Tests Explained
High Blood Pressure Screening: This easy test determines the force of blood versus the walls of the arteries. High blood pressure can cause extreme health concerns like cardiovascular disease, making regular tracking essential.
Cholesterol Tests: Lipid panels examine cholesterol levels and can suggest the threat of cardiovascular disease. Adults ought to have their cholesterol inspected routinely, especially if they have threat aspects such as obesity or family history.
Blood Sugar Tests: This test determines blood glucose levels and assists diagnose diabetes or prediabetes, conditions that can have serious long-term complications.
Cancer Screenings: Tests such as mammograms for breast cancer and colonoscopies for colorectal cancer are important as they can cause early intervention and better results.
Mental Health Screenings: Conditions such as stress and anxiety and depression can significantly affect lifestyle. Regular psychological health evaluations can aid in recognizing those who may need support or treatment.
Frequently Asked Questions about Adult Health Testing
1. How frequently should adults get their health checked?
The frequency of health testing depends on individual health status, age, and danger factors. Nevertheless, usually, healthy adults must consider annual check-ups and particular screenings (like cholesterol checks or colonoscopies) every few years based on age and suggestions.
2. Are there threats connected with health testing?
While the benefits usually exceed the threats, some tests might require follow-up treatments or can result in unnecessary anxiety if irregular results happen. It's necessary to talk about these worry about a health care provider.
3. Can lifestyle changes lower the need for certain tests?
Yes, embracing a much healthier lifestyle, such as a balanced diet plan, regular workout, and preventing smoking cigarettes or extreme alcohol, can reduce the danger of diseases and possibly lower the frequency of specific tests.
4. How can I prepare for a health screening?
Preparation may differ by test. For circumstances, fasting may be required before blood tests, while particular directions may be essential for imaging tests. Always consult your healthcare supplier for the right preparatory actions.
5. Are there particular tests that are not needed for all adults?
Indeed, not all adults need every test. Tailored health screenings ought to think about family history, current health problems, and lifestyle. A health care supplier can help figure out which tests are most useful for each individual.
